Output fef42ef0100633321d9a71c536584b72db6773e46bf357dcb669de21e6ef5d72:32

value
17484924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 076d50bbefe2e5116e9e65eb06ae0a8da077b11b OP_EQUAL
address
M8aRv8xAMjgWkaGLrDEEPQTebwtJAnkc6h
transaction
fef42ef0100633321d9a71c536584b72db6773e46bf357dcb669de21e6ef5d72
spent
true